草庐IT

【Linux】进程信号

全部标签

linux - 有时在 windows 和 linux 中 mktime 的结果不同

这是函数time_ttime_from_string(constchar*timestr){if(!timestr)return0;structtmt1;memset(&t1,0,sizeof(t1));intnfields=sscanf(timestr,"%04d:%02d:%02d%02d:%02d:%02d",&t1.tm_year,&t1.tm_mon,&t1.tm_mday,&t1.tm_hour,&t1.tm_min,&t1.tm_sec);if(nfields!=6)return0;t1.tm_year-=1900;t1.tm_mon--;t1.tm_isdst=-1;/

c++ - 用于检测启动和终止的应用程序/进程的 WIN32 API

这个问题在这里已经有了答案:Howtodetectwin32processcreation/terminationinc++(9个回答)关闭9年前。我正在寻找一个WIN32API来检测应用程序在我的应用程序中的启动和终止。我正在寻找开发一个dockBar/TaskBar,我需要为它获取启动和终止的应用程序的句柄。

Java:从命令行运行时重定向内部进程输出

我使用以下代码来重定向我从我的Java应用程序启动的进程的输出:ProcessBuilderbuilder=newProcessBuilder("MyProcess.exe");builder.redirectOutput(Redirect.INHERIT);builder.redirectErrorStream(true);现在,当我从eclipse运行代码时,它工作正常-我可以在Eclipse的控制台中看到输出。然而,当我创建一个jar文件并从cmd窗口运行它时,例如java-jarMyJar.jar,它不打印进程的输出。这可能是什么原因? 最佳答案

c++ - SYSTEM 进程是否可以与非 SYSTEM 进程共享数据?

我正在尝试使用QSharedMemory和QClipboard在SYSTEM进程(在WinSta0\\Winlogon桌面)和普通用户进程,但都无法与普通桌面上运行的其他非SYSTEM进程共享数据。我相信这是因为WinSta0\\Winlogon桌面是一个独立的桌面。我的应用是一个拍摄Windows安全桌面并将其发送到剪贴板的程序。问题是:有没有办法在该进程和非SYSTEM进程之间共享内存数据?(实际上我正在使用一个文件来完成这项工作)。 最佳答案 在WindowsVista及更高版本中,系统服务在隔离的session(“sessi

windows - 如何在 Windows 中找到删除/移动给定文件的进程

假设我在一台Windows机器上删除了(或者可能移动或重命名)了一些文件。现在我想找出删除/移动它们的过程。我该怎么做? 最佳答案 假设您在代码中需要这个,唯一的选择是让文件系统过滤器驱动程序拦截请求并捕获您需要的信息。我们的CallbackFilter产品允许在用户模式下执行此操作(包括驱动程序)。其他选项(不在代码中)是对有问题的文件启用审核并使用ProcMon工具(Sysinternals的ProcessMonitor)来监控文件。 关于windows-如何在Windows中找到删

linux - Windows 生产服务器上的 Drupal 7 和 WordPress 3.8?

我已经很多年没有Windows生产服务器了。根据最近的统计数据,很少有人在运行WAMP生产服务器,而拥有WIMP的人就更少了。我认识的大多数Web开发人员仅将WAMP用于开发目的(例如,我目前在本地桌面上安装了WampServer)。也就是说,我在.Net商店工作,因此,虽然我的任务是用Drupal或WordPress(或两者)为公司制作网站,但我被告知服务器有拥有Windows操作系统,以便利用内部知识来支持服务器。Windows和Drupal/WordPress(即PHP和MySQL)是唯一给定的技术标准;我可以决定它将是哪种Windows服务器,以及任何必要的配置。我想听听任何有

java - 如果预期的目标应用程序已经在运行,如何停止 installanywhere 安装程序进程

我们使用InstallAnywhere2012部署了一个Java应用程序。部署的应用程序有一个版本通知机制,弹出一个网站,并鼓励用户下载并启动“新版本”,而“旧版本”可能仍在运行。在此过程中有一个“请退出”对话框,但用户通常不会退出,安装“新版本”的行为通常只会覆盖未锁定的文件,这会导致无法安装,直到用户执行干净重新安装。如果“旧版本”当前正在运行,我想修改实际安装程序以退出,要求用户先退出它。IA提供了一种“执行自定义代码”的方法,它可以指向一个jar文件。因此,我创建了一个独立的可运行jar程序,如果一切正常,该程序将以代码0退出,如果检测到“旧版本”正在运行,则以代码1退出,这取

linux - 如何将远程 Linux 服务器日志文件拖到本地 Windows 机器

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。这个问题似乎不是关于aspecificprogrammingproblem,asoftwarealgorithm,orsoftwaretoolsprimarilyusedbyprogrammers的.如果您认为这个问题是关于anotherStackExchangesite的主题,您可以发表评论,说明问题可能在哪里得到解答。关闭9年前。Improvethisquestion我有一个在Linux服务器上运行的应用程序,它会在该服务器上生成日志文件。我个人使用Windows机器,想知道是否有任何方法可以跟踪

linux - Windows下无法访问Alfresco的CIFS

我在Ubuntu13.10下成功安装了Alfresco4.2.d,使用IP:192.168.0.200(mbnoimi-virtual),可以通过网络毫无问题地使用网页界面。但是我无法使用Windows共享访问CIFS。我尝试通过这些方式访问CIFS,但都失败了!\\mbnoimi-virtuala\\mbnoimi-virtuala\Alfresco\\192.168.0.200\Alfresco错误信息Checkthespellingofthename.Otherwise,theremightbeaproblemwithyournetwork.Totryidentifyandres

C++ ofstream 写入在 Windows 下不起作用。在 Linux 下工作正常

以下代码在Windows和GNUC++、VS10、VS12、IntelC++14.0下不起作用。下面的代码在Linux和GNUC++4.7、4.8、IntelC++14、Open645.0下工作。在内部测试for循环中用DIMEN-256替换DIMEN...有效!?任何的想法?//============================////ReadandWritebinaryfile////usingbuffers////============================//#include#include#include#includeusingnamespacestd;i